Abstract:

In this paper we deal with some problems concerning minimal hypersurfaces in Carnot-Carathéodory (CC) structures. More precisely we will introduce a general {\it calibration method} in this setting and we will study the {\it Bernstein problem} for entire regular intrinsic minimal graphs in a meaningful and simpler class of CC spaces, i.e. the Heisenberg group $H^n$. In particular we will positively answer to the Bernstein problem in the case $n=1$ and we will provide counterexamples when $n\geq 5$.
